Airbag module for automotive vehicle
An airbag module for an automotive vehicle is disclosed. The airbag module comprises a folded inflatable airbag, a fastening element for mounting the airbag on the vehicle, a mounting jacket in which the folded airbag is received and fixed, as well as an elongate flexible holding strap for positioning the airbag in its deployed inflated state. The holding strap extends from a first strap end fastened on the airbag to an opposite second strap end to which the fastening element is attached. In the folded state of the airbag, the holding strap is connected to the mounting jacket or is received in the mounting jacket.

Roof airbag for vehicle
Proposed is a roof airbag that is disposed at the roof of a vehicle and is deployed into an interior space of the vehicle. A bracket is provided to the roof. An inflator is connected to the bracket and configured to discharge an inflation gas when operated. An airbag cushion is provided to an airbag cover connected to the bracket in a foldable way and deployed into an interior space of the vehicle by the inflation gas supplied by the inflator. A tether is configured such that one end thereof is fixed to the roof side, and the other end of which is connected to the airbag cushion. The tether supports the airbag cushion so that, when the airbag cushion is deployed, the airbag cushion is deployed toward a seat.

SEAT-MOUNTED AIRBAG DEVICE
A seat-mounted airbag device includes an inflator, an airbag body, and a guide member. The airbag body includes a front-rear chamber and a tip chamber. The front-rear chamber is deployed forward of a seat through a clearance between a window and a head of an occupant from a side portion of a headrest on a window side by gas ejected from the inflator and disposed between the window and the head of the occupant. The tip chamber is deployed inward in a seat width direction from an end portion of the front-rear chamber on a seat front side and disposed forward of a face of the occupant on the seat front side. The guide member protrudes from the side portion prior to deployment of the airbag body and is interposed between the airbag body and the head of the occupant.

AIRBAG HOLDING COVER AND VEHICLE AIRBAG DEVICE
A retaining cover that encapsulates a cushion which is stowed in a bulk stowed form in front of the regular seating position of the vehicle having a side surface retaining part wound around a side surface of the cushion in stowed form, a cloth-like part provided in a manner traversing vertically across the upper surface of the cushion in stowed form, and a weak part provided at a prescribed location on the cloth-like part that divides the cloth-like part to an upper piece and lower piece due to the expansion pressure of the cushion. If the cushion expands and deploys with the occupant in close proximity, the upper piece of the cloth-like part is sandwiched in between the cushion and the occupant, such that the upper piece restrains the upward deployment of the cushion.
